低频超声对大鼠颊囊黏膜溃疡组织SOD、MDA含量的影响

摘    要:目的探讨不同功率低频超声处理实验性SD大鼠颊囊黏膜溃疡组织中超氧化物歧化酶(SOD)、丙二醛(MDA)含量的影响。方法将36只健康SD大鼠随机分为对照组(n=6)及大鼠颊囊黏膜溃疡模型组(n=30);溃疡模型组根据不同处理方式分为溃疡组(n=6),药物组(n=6)及低频超声组(n=18),低频超声组大鼠按超声波输出功率再分为1.10、1.58、2.06 W组,每组6只。治疗结束24h后观察各组大鼠溃疡的愈合时间;制备溃疡组织匀浆,采用分光光度计测定大鼠颊囊黏膜溃疡组织中SOD、MDA含量。结果药物组及低频超声组大鼠颊囊黏膜溃疡的平均愈合时间均比溃疡组短(P<0.05),但不同功率低频超声组大鼠颊囊黏膜溃疡的愈合时间比较,差异无统计学意义(P>0.05)。处理结束24h后,低频超声组大鼠颊囊黏膜组织中SOD含量较溃疡组显著升高(P<0.05),而其与对照组、药物组比较差异无统计学意义(P>0.05),溃疡组中SOD含量较对照组显著降低(P<0.05);低频超声组中MDA含量较溃疡组显著降低(P<0.05),与对照组、药物组比较差异无统计学意义(P>0.05),溃疡组中MDA含量较对照组显著升高(P<0.05)。结论安全范围输出功率的脉冲低频超声能有效升高组织中SOD活性,降低MDA含量,对溃疡的愈合有一定的促进作用。

Effects of low-frequency ultrasound irradiation on SOD and MDA levels in cheek pouch mucosa ulcer tissue of rats

Abstract:Objective To observe the effects of different energy levels of low-frequency ultrasound irradiation on the changes of SOD and MDA levels in ulcer tissue of rat oral ulcer model.Methods Thirty Sprague-Daw-ley rats were inflicted with oral ulcer,and then randomly and equally assigned to 5 groups,oral ulcer group,1% iodine glycerin group and the rest 3 groups receiving low-frequency ultrasound irradiation at 1.1,1.58,2.06 W(once per day,for consecutive 3 d).The other 6 rats served as normal control.In 24 h after last treatment,3 rats from each group were sacrificed and their cheek pouches were taken out for detecting SOD and MDA levels in the mucosal tissue by spectrophotometry.Ulcer healing was observed at 24 h after the last treatment for consecutive 8 d.The efficiency of low-frequency ultrasound irradiation at different powers was evaluated.Results The level of SOD in 1.1,1.58,2.06 W groups was significantly higher than that of the ulcer group(P<0.05).The level of MDA in 1.1,1.58,2.06 W groups was significantly lower than that of the ulcer group(P<0.05),but the level of SOD and MDA had no significant difference(P>0.05) between the 1.1,1.58,2.06 W groups and the control group.Conclusion Low-frequency ultrasound in safe range of output power increases the SOD activity and decreases the MDA content effectively,and has certain promoting effect on ulcer healing.
